- AccessoryAccessory useA secondary activity customarily incidental to the main use of the lot — a garage, a home office. structure rear setbackSetbackThe distance a building must be held back from a lot line.10 ft
The minimum rear yard width for each accessory structure shall be ten feet.
- AccessoryAccessory useA secondary activity customarily incidental to the main use of the lot — a garage, a home office. structure side setbackSetbackThe distance a building must be held back from a lot line.10 ft
The minimum side yard width for each accessory structure shall be ten feet.
- SetbackSetbackThe distance a building must be held back from a lot line. from road with ROW <50 ft85 ft
The setback from any VDOT secondary road, private street, or subdivision street with a right-of-way less than 50 feet in width shall be 85 feet from the centerline of the road.
- Maximum guestrooms for rural retreat50 guestrooms
A rural retreat may be permitted an additional guestroom for every two (2) full acres above thirty (30) acres, not to exceed a total of fifty (50) guestrooms.
- SetbackSetbackThe distance a building must be held back from a lot line. from shoreline50 ft
The setback for any new dwelling shall be a minimum of 50 feet from the shoreline of any body of water.
- Temporary sales hours
Special events are permitted only between the hours of 7:00 a.m. to 10:00 p.m., Sunday through Thursday; and 7:00 a.m. to 12:00 a.m., Friday and Saturday.
Signage
- Maximum total sign area32 sqftsq ftSquare feet. An acre is 43,560 sq ft; a typical suburban lot is 7,000–10,000.
The total area of permanent signs shall be 32 square feet or less.
- Maximum sign heightMaximum heightThe tallest a building may be, given in feet, in storeys, or both — whichever binds first.8 ft
Monument signs and pylon signs shall be eight feet or less in height.
From the ordinance
In the agricultural zoning district, the minimum lot area shall be two acres, except in cluster developments subject to article VI, or manufactured home parks subject to article VII.
